Peach Beach is the second track of the Mushroom Cup in Mario Kart: Double Dash!! and is one of only two tracks to commence on Isle Delfino in the Mario Kart series. The second is Delfino Square.

In Mario Kart: Double Dash[]

Peach Beach's main features are the tide - low tide can result in a sub-shortcut - the Cataquacks, which launch racers into the air upon contact and make them drag and having the Daisy Cruiser in the background. It is also notable for hosting the awards ceremony.

Towards the finish line is the Pinata Statue, which also appeared in Delfino Plaza.

There is a shortcut found at the beginning, by turning left where the player can see a pipe. Entering it will give a player the Double Item Box.

In Mario Kart Wii[]

The track re-appears as a retro track. The layout stays the same and the graphics change very little. Cataquacks chase after racers if they approach nearby. In Time Trials, Cataquacks do not chase racers.
